Nongladew Mawsmai RCLP: A Rural Primary School in Meghalaya

Nongladew Mawsmai RCLP, a primary school nestled in the rural landscape of Meghalaya, India, stands as a testament to the dedication to education in even the most remote areas. Established in 1980 and managed by the Department of Education, this co-educational institution provides crucial primary education to the children of the Jirang block in Ri Bhoi district. Its unique characteristics and operational details offer a fascinating glimpse into the realities of rural education in the region.

The school's infrastructure, while modest, serves its purpose effectively. Housed in a private building, it boasts three well-maintained classrooms, providing ample space for instruction. The school also features separate facilities for non-teaching activities, and a dedicated room for the head teacher, Mr. Nathan B. Marak, underscoring the importance placed on administrative support. While lacking a boundary wall and electricity, the school compensates with accessible facilities, notably ramps for disabled children, ensuring inclusivity for all learners.

The school's academic focus is primarily on providing primary education, encompassing classes from 1 to 5. Garo, a local language, serves as the medium of instruction, fostering a culturally sensitive learning environment. The school's commitment to education extends beyond the classroom, with the provision of midday meals prepared on-site, ensuring students' nutritional needs are met. The presence of a pre-primary section further expands the school's reach to younger children.

The teaching staff consists of two male teachers, highlighting the dedication of these individuals to serve their community.
